Tenuta Frescobaldi 2023 Vermentino Massovivo Ammiraglia
A bracingly fresh, mineralādriven Vermentino from the Maremma coast that strikes a beautiful balance between vibrant citrus, herbal nuance, and saline sophisticationādelicious now yet versatile for food pairings or sipping in the sun.
šæ Origins & Terroir
-
Produced at Tenuta Ammiraglia in Tuscan Maremma, where Vermentino vines thrive on sunlit slopes reaching the Tyrrhenian Sea; the terroir features the regionās trademark āmassive yellow boulders,ā giving the wine its name, Massovivo (āliving stoneā)Ā
-
Crafted from 100% Vermentino, handāharvested late September. Fermented and aged on fine lees in stainless steel (4 months), then bottled after one monthĀ
š Aromatics
-
Bright floral top notes: jasmine, hawthorn, and broom.
-
At its core are crisp citrus fruits: bergamot, lime, yellow pear, and hints of honey and almond, with Mediterranean herb whispersāsage, thyme, rosemaryāand evocative iodine/marine breezesĀ
š Taste Profile
-
Texture: Medium-bodied, round, yet litheāthanks to lees aging and cooling maritime influenceĀ
-
Palette: Crisp citrus (lemon, lime), white peach, and pear, bolstered by savory marine salinity, herbal complexity, and a persistent mineralityĀ
-
Finish: Long, fresh, and savory, with minerality and a citrusāherb echo lingering on the palate .
š½ Food Pairings & Serving
-
Serve chilled (8ā10āÆĀ°C) in a tulip or whiteāwine glass.
-
Superb with seafood starters, shellfish, grilled fish, vegetable pasta, or lighter cheeses such as fresh goat or burrata
-
Also delightful as anĀ aperitif, especially in warm weatherĀ
